Acem*
Used to reduce swelling externally and bleeding internally. *a handful of acem

Andilay*
Andilay root is used for fatigue; it clears the head and eases tired muscles. *a bundle of andilay root

Asping Rot
Asping rot is a potent poison, even a drop can kill. It kills quickly and peacefully within an hour of ingestion. The poison appears to have strong narcotic or sedative properties.

Blackwasp Nettles*
Nettles sting when fresh, and blackwasp emphasises the strength of the sting. *a bunch of blackwasp nettles

Blisterleaf
It grows in a patch. The plant causes a rapid skin reaction and rash, but also slows the poison from Thakan'dar blades.

Blue Goatflowers***
A hot poultice made with the water from boiled blue goatflowers will greatly improve the healing of a broken bone. ***a small pile of blue goatflower petals

Bluespine*
Has no medicinal value. Bitter tasting, used as punishment by the Aiel. *a few pieces of bluespine

Bluewort
A tea of bluewort settles a queasy stomach.

Boneknit*
Taken internally for bone fractures. *a bunch of boneknit

Broomweed**
Used as a signal for the Yellow Ajah. Yields a strong yellow Dye and can be bundled to make a broom. **a few stalks of yellow broomweed

Catfern
Boiled catfern tastes terrible and is used as punishment.

Chainleaf*
Used to settle a queasy stomach. *a bunch of chainleaf leaves

Corenroot*
Assists with the regeneration of blood cells. *a handful of corenroot

Crimsonthorn*
The root of this plant is harvested as a painkiller in small doses. In higher doses it works as a paralytic, eventually causing death by asphyxiation. *a cluster of crimsonthorn root

Dogwood*
Tastes terrible, is used as a punishment and coercion to lift depression. *a bouquet of dogwood leaves

Dogwort***
Assists in the healing of wounds. ***some fuzzy green dogwort leaves

Feverbane*
Aid for the breaking of a fever. Used in conjunction with Acem to cute the white shakes. *a handful of feverbane

Five-finger*
Used to heal bruises. Works well as an ointment combined with sunburst root and ground ivy. *a bundle of five-finger

Flatwort***
Used to treat fatigue. It clears the head and eases tired muscles. ***a blue pouch of flatwort tea

Forkroot***
A paralytic drug that has particular effect against channelers. A distilled tincture is strong enough to cut them from the source. Has a stronger effect on men. Used by the Seanchan to ferret out damane. It has a cool, minty taste. ***a packet of dried brown forkroot

Foxtail*
A sleep aid that doesn't leave traces of grogginess. *a handfull of foxtail

Gheandin***
Used to treat heart complaints. The powdered form can be used to induce sneezing in order to relieve headaches and earaches. Has some effect on poison relief. ***a vial of powdered red gheandin blossom

Goatstongue*
Used to make a patient sleepy and also relieve stomach cramps. *a handful of goatstongue

Goosemint
Eases digestion and upset stomachs.

Greenwort*
Used with Goatstongue to make a tea for sleep. Also used to relieve cramps. *a few leaves of greenwort

Grey Fennel***
A rapid acting poison used to coat weaponry, favored by assassins. May be beneficial in extremely small quantities. ***a gray fennel plant

Ground Ivy***
Used to relieve pain and heal bruises. May be of some assistance in fatigue relief. ***a sack of green ivy

Healall**
Used in an ointment for open wounds. **a white healall root

Heartleaf*
Taken in a tea as a contraceptive. *a handful of heartleaf leaves

Honey**
Used for energy and to soothe sore throats. **a tincture of a thick yellow liquid

Itchoak
Used to irritate the skin and cause blistering.

Itchweed*
A poisonous plant which irritates the skin. *a cluster of itchweed

Lionheart*
Relieves pain. *a bundle of lionheart
